poldek :)
Paweł A. Gajda
mis w pld.org.pl
Nie, 26 Maj 2002, 23:20:23 CEST
niedziela 26/05/2002 20:21:16, Jarosław Kamper:
> On Sun, May 26, 2002 at 06:18:42PM +0200, Paweł A. Gajda wrote:
> > piątek 24/05/2002 12:14:27, Jarosław Kamper:
> > > [jack w pldworkstation jack]$ sudo poldek -n nest-test -U kernel-source
> > > Retrieving ftp://[...]/kernel-source-2.4.18-2.36.i686.rpm...
> > > . ................................................. 100.0% [21.4M]
> > > błąd: unpacking of archive failed na pliku /usr/src/linux-2.4.18/kernel/printk.c: cpio: MD5 sum mismatch
> > >
[...]
>
> Mi chodziło bardziej o to, że pakiet się nie zainstalował (poprawnie), a
> został skasowany - do poprawy poldek?
Nie:
1) żeby stwierdzić, że pakiet jest OK i nie trzeba go pobierać, poldek
sprawdza jego MD5 za pomocą funkcji z rpmlib
2) rpmlib przy weryfikacji MD5 pakietu kopiuje jego zawartość
(archiwum cpio.gz) gdzieś na dysk, co się z braku miejsca nie powiodło
i zgłoszona została porażka
3) porażka <=> zła suma <=> walnięty pakiet <=> poldek usuwa go
i ściąga raz jeszcze.
Swoją drogą dziwne, że nie dostałeś do rpm-a ładnego:
installing package kernel-source-2.2.19-26 needs 83Mb on the / filesystem
zamiast tego "MD5 sum mismatch"
Masz gdzieś wstawione --ignoresize?
Więcej informacji o liście dyskusyjnej pld-installer